Intelligent Code Review and Debugging

Reviewing and debugging code can be a challenging task, especially in large and complex projects. It requires a thorough grasp of the codebase, attention to detail, and a lot of time. However, with the advent of machine learning, this process is becoming more efficient and effective. Intelligent code review and debugging tools are being developed that can analyze code and identify potential errors and issues.

These tools use predictive code analysis to identify patterns and anomalies in the code, allowing developers to catch errors early on. Automated error detection is also becoming more prevalent, enabling developers to focus on writing code rather than fixing it. This not merely saves time but also reduces the likelihood of errors making it to production. Additionally, machine learning algorithms can analyze code reviews and provide suggestions for improvement, making the code review process more efficient and effective. Building Smarter Software Systems

intelligent software system development

Machine learning is transforming software development by injecting intelligence into the systems being built. This shift is enabling the creation of smarter software systems that can learn, adapt, and evolve over time. By integrating machine learning algorithms into software design, developers can build systems that are more responsive to user needs, more resilient to errors, and more efficient in their operations.

One key application of machine learning in software development is predictive software maintenance. By analyzing usage patterns and system performance data, machine learning models can identify potential issues before they occur, allowing developers to proactively address problems and reduce downtime. Furthermore, AI-driven software architecture is emerging as a promising approach to building more intelligent and adaptive systems. This involves using machine learning algorithms to generate and optimize system designs, leading to more efficient, scalable, and reliable software systems. Can Machine Learning Replace Human Software Developers Entirely?

Sophisticated systems spark speculation: can machine learning replace human software developers entirely? Though AI-assisted software design and autonomous code generation are progressing speedily, they aren't likely to supplant humans completely. Machine learning can efficiently analyze data and generate code, but it still requires human oversight, creativity, and contextual comprehension. It's more probable that AI will augment human capabilities, freeing developers to focus on high-level problem-solving and complex decision-making.

What Are the Biggest Challenges in Implementing Machine Learning in Software Development?

Implementing machine learning in software development comes with its set of challenges. One major hurdle is the lack of domain expertise, as developers may not have the necessary knowledge to effectively integrate machine learning models. Another significant challenge is managing training data complexity, which can be overwhelming, especially when dealing with large datasets.
